International statistical consulting

Statistics Finland is an active member of the international statistical community. We are committed to complying with international codes of conduct, quality criteria and recommendations for the development, production and dissemination of statistics. Statistics Finland also takes part in knowledge sharing in different domains and supports statistical capacity development in partner countries.

The aim of international statistical consulting is to

  • support less developed countries to rebuild and improve their official statistics
  • develop own personnel's international project skills.

Finnish statistics ecosystem is ranked high in global performance indicators The Statistical Performance Indicators is a service provided by the World Bank. The indicators measure the capacity and maturity of national statistical systems by assessing the use of data, the quality of services, the coverage of topics, the sources of information, and the infrastructure and availability of resources. For the past three years, Finland has been among the top performers. Put simply, the statistical performance of economies is defined by how well, how broadly and how frequently national statistical systems collect, produce and disseminate high-quality data in a publicly accessible manner. The set of indicators contains 51 indicators to assess performance organised according to five pillars: data use, data services, data products, data sources and data infrastructure. Finland scores high in all pillars.
